Key Responsibilities

Taking responsibility for making sure we provide a great educational experience for our apprentices. This would include:

  • Monitoring programme aims and objectives - including the progression and achievement rates of learners
  • Proactively working with the skills coach team to find ways to improve our service to apprentices
  • Scheduling and planning the delivery of our "Impact Skills Programme" for FI Midlands
  • Providing reports, analysis and recommendations to management/ Board on all quality and compliance matters for FI Online and Midlands

Ensuring the quality and compliance of apprenticeship delivery. This would include:

  • Working with other teams to ensure our delivery meets OFSTED, ESFA and internal quality requirements
  • Retaining full and up to date knowledge of apprenticeship funding regulations and guidance
  • Ensuring that systems used for monitoring and tracking progress of our apprenticeships are fit for purpose and up to date
  • Oversight of apprentice cohort allocation to Skills Coaches, and monitor to ensure appropriate workloads
  • Attendance at monthly quality, finance and other governance meetings

Management of the Skills Coach team. You will build, manage and lead a team of coaches who provide critical support to the progression and completion of our apprentices. This would include:

  • Recruiting and onboarding new coaches
  • Supporting the Coach Team Lead with day to day line management
  • Working with other FI Heads of Apprenticeships to adopt and share best practice in team training and development, and to manage short term gaps in coach demand across FI Limited

Supporting client engagement. You will work with the client team to help engage, inform and grow our client base. This would include:

  • Providing information, advice and guidance to existing apprenticeship clients and apprentices and new potential employers
  • Involvement in client engagement processes, ensuring pitch documents and contractual terms are compliant
  • Supporting the Admissions Manager and Client Service teams in the review of client learner eligibility
  • Assist Skills Coach team and other internal stakeholders with programme pathway planning
  • Attendance at regional sales meetings
